How to reset your apple watch?

On your Apple Watch, tap Settings > General > Reset > Erase All Content and Settings. Type your password if prompted. For GPS + Cellular models, choose to keep or remove your cellular plan.

Also the question is, how do I do a hard reset on my Apple Watch? You should force restart your device as a last resort and only if it’s not responding. To force restart your Apple Watch, press and hold both the side button and Digital Crown for at least 10 seconds, then release both buttons when you see the Apple logo.

Also, can you reset a locked Apple Watch? Press and hold the side button until you see Power Off. Press and hold the Digital Crown until you see Erase all content and settings. Tap Reset, then tap Reset again to confirm. Wait for the process to finish, then set up your Apple Watch again.

Correspondingly, how do I restart my Apple Watch pairing? Press and hold the Digital Crown while your Apple Watch is in pairing mode. Tap Reset when it appears on your watch. After your watch resets, you can pair again.

Why can’t I reset my Apple Watch?

If your Apple Watch is unresponsive when attempting to erase it, then it may help to first force restart it: Remove it from the charger and hold both the side button and Digital Crown for at least 10 seconds, releasing them when the Apple logo is displayed.

Can you unlock a Apple Watch?

You can unlock Apple Watch manually, by entering the passcode, or set it to unlock automatically when you unlock your iPhone. Enter the passcode: Wake Apple Watch, enter the watch passcode, then tap OK. … You can also open the Apple Watch app on your iPhone, tap My Watch, tap Passcode, then turn on Unlock with iPhone.

How do I resync my Apple watch to my phone?

  1. On your iPhone, open the Watch app.
  2. Tap General.
  3. Scroll down and tap Reset.
  4. Tap Reset Sync Data.
  5. Your iPhone will now erase all contacts and calendar data on your Apple Watch along with sync settings before starting the sync process again and resyncing all your data.

Why is my watch not connected to my iPhone?

If your Apple Watch isn’t pairing with your iPhone, there are a number of ways you can fix the connection. First, make sure both devices have Wi-Fi and Bluetooth enabled and are in range of each other. Then, try restarting your Apple Watch and iPhone, as well as resetting your iPhone’s network settings.

What happens if you unpair your Apple Watch?

When you unpair your Apple Watch from your iPhone, the watch is backed up completely to your iPhone to make sure that the latest data is saved. … This means that when you set up a new iPhone and restore it from backup, your latest Apple Watch data is also restored.
